Job Description & How to Apply Below

Responsible for promoting the success of the player’s club by assisting guests through all facets of the membership process, promotional gift distribution/preparation, and seating of guests for ticketed functions.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following:

  • Enrolls new guests in the player’s club.
  • Executes casino gift events.
  • Maintains a working knowledge of the player’s club in order to effectively explain same to guests.
  • Prepares promotional gift product by counting and unboxing product and, in some instances, palletizing product.
  • Transports promotional product from pre-event storage locations to promotional event locations through the use of a pallet jack.
  • Verifies guest identification for promotional event eligibility.
  • Redeems promotional gift coupons through database gaming software with a working knowledge of additional aspects of same. Identifies and verifies promotional drawing winners.
  • Distributes complimentary event tickets designated for casino customers at specified locations within the casino.
  • Uses ticket scanner equipment to accurately verify individual event tickets brought by patrons to event entry locations.
  • Seats patrons in designated locations as specified on individual patron tickets. Has a good working knowledge of event seating layout.
  • Assists as designated during other marketing events held at the property, including invited player parties, slot tournaments and Bingo.
  • Inspects and re-stocks player’s club printed material.
  • Issues complimentaries for guests when appropriate level of play has been established.
  • Assists in preparing necessary materials for guests arriving via scheduled bus line runs and charter buses.
  • Greets guests arriving via scheduled line run buses and chartered bus trips.
  • Provides smooth and efficient service to guests.
  • Maintains a working knowledge of casino facilities, as well as current and upcoming special events, in order to advise guests and fellow employees, whenever possible.
  • Facilitates the flow of information throughout the department by attending scheduled departmental meetings.
  • Ensures a maximum level of guest service and satisfaction is achieved and maintained.
  • Must be detail oriented and be able to manage multiple tasks.
